Malignant peripheral nerve sheath tumour presenting with Horner's syndrome.

Sumitra Basuthakur, Amitava Sengupta, Ankan Bandyopadhyay, Arpita Banerjee.   

Abstract

A young male presented with clinical and radiological features of right apical lung mass and Horner's syndrome. Subsequently the patient was diagnosed as a case of malignant peripheral nerve sheath tumour (MPNST) at the apex of right lung originating from an intercostal nerve and compressing ipsilateral cervical sympathetic plexus and lower cord of brachial plexus, in a case of neurofibromatosis type 1.
